+(* These examples show somehow arbitrary choices of generalization wrt
+ to indices, when those indices are not linear. We check here 8.4
+ compatibility: when an index is a subterm of a parameter of the
+ inductive type, it is not generalized. *)
+
+Inductive repr (x:nat) : nat -> Prop := reprc z : repr x z -> repr x z.
+
+Goal forall x, 0 = x -> repr x x -> True.
+intros x H1 H.
+induction H.
+change True in IHrepr.
+Abort.
+
+Goal forall x, 0 = S x -> repr (S x) (S x) -> True.
+intros x H1 H.
+induction H.
+change True in IHrepr.
+Abort.
+
+Inductive repr' (x:nat) : nat -> Prop := reprc' z : repr' x (S z) -> repr' x z.
+
+Goal forall x, 0 = x -> repr' x x -> True.
+intros x H1 H.
+induction H.
+change True in IHrepr'.
+Abort.
